Celebrities and entertainment moguls love to call the shots, and nothing is more exhilarating than owning a piece of a sports team. From sailing and paddleball to soccer and football, the trend of celebrity ownership in sports has gained significant traction in recent years. High-profile figures like Anne Hathaway and Drake are among those who have ventured into the world of sports, blending their passion for athletics with their business acumen.
Owning a sports team not only provides these stars with a unique investment opportunity but also allows them to engage with their fans in new and exciting ways. The allure of sports ownership is multifaceted; it offers a platform for philanthropy, brand promotion, and personal enjoyment. As celebrities leverage their influence to support their teams, they also help to elevate the profile of the sports they are involved in, creating a win-win situation for both the stars and the athletes.
This growing trend highlights the intersection of entertainment and sports, showcasing how Hollywood's elite are redefining their roles in the athletic arena.
